To make the figure in this sculpture, a sleeping bag was draped to suggest the contours of a human body and then cast in clay. The thousands of empty bullet casings that surround the ceramic form become a protective barrier. “In some way,” artist Rebecca Belmore (b. 1960) has said, “the work carries an emptiness. But at the same time, because it’s a standing figure, I am hoping that the work contains some positive aspects of this idea that we need to try to deal with violence.”

As part of a super fun, recent Gallery Tour, we stopped in at the Jack Shainman Gallery for a peek at Jackie Nickerson’s photographic exhibit of unorthodox portraiture, entitled Field Test. While the series features female figures (two different models were used) whose faces and bodies are covered or wrapped in assorted plastic materials, Field Test was actually conceived and completed before the Covid19 pandemic. This work, entitled Wrapped, depicts a women in a seated position, knees pulled to her chest, while obscured entirely in a sheet of opaque Pink plastic, making it an ideal choice for this week’s Pink Thing of The Day. Field Test is a fascinating series which is on exhibit through April 3rd, 2021.

In his early twenties, Christo (Born Christo Javacheff in 1935) escaped the oppressive Communist regime in his native country of Bulgaria and wandered in exile throughout Europe, supporting himself primarily by painting commissioned portraits.
